I've been trying to learn Engineer since the Mage nerf pretty much killed the class. I've been able to climb back to a ~15% win rate with Engineer in Duo slowly acclimatizing with the class though I still think I should be playing an assassin and we're back to 40% in Squad once I dropped the mage. I think the Mage nerf was necessary for the patch at hand but since then the changes in the game are already a nerf to the mage's kit and playstyle. Mage worked very well at one-shotting people but that's also the only way mages work.

With a huge TTK you often can't finish a fight fast enough before others come in, and resetting is useless because now that mage doesn't have its damage you're either forced to:
* Fight long distance, at which point you'll lose to a hunter or assassin
* Fight medium range, which you had an advantage before, but not enough now, especially if the enemy gap closes to you.
* Fight short range, at which point you're at a disadvantage against every single class unless you bait into Ice Block perfectly, at which point you lose your reset. In some situations a perfect bait can make a 1-for-2 skills but also offers the enemy the option to reset. Not even counting the moments you'll get headshot as soon as the CD ends.

So the TTK changes are a massive nerf to mages, and the weapon changes were also a huge nerf. Mage is simultaneously the class that relied the most on its Class Weapon to do the damage, and also the class with one of the worst class weapons. In a group there's no reason to give a mage her class weapon over the assassin, which will then make him excel at both short and long range; the warrior which will murder people at short and medium range; and then a tie between the hunter's which is just downright better right now than the staff, or the engineer who can do the jump+splash combo with his weapon very easily or use his weapon to deal massive damage against campers along with his other skills.

As far as I'm aware rank right now is:
Up until Master: An average of your position in your best 50 matches. The higher, the better. Some ranks are gated:
Diamond 3 requires 1 win (I think)
Diamond 2 requires 10 wins
Diamond 1 requires 25 wins
Master requires 50 wins

Then Master is a ladder showing the total amount of kills from your highest kill-scoring 50 victories.

All based on your final team position from my observation. Might be wrong.
